(8分)阅读理解 Teens want structure in their lives, which means they want their lives well-planned. To begin building structure, teens need love and trust. They need to know their parents are there to give them needed love and support. Teens want to be sure that nothing can prevent parents from shouldering their responsibility for them not their growing maturity (成熟),misbehavior, nor anger at something they have done. Teens want parents to keep control while allowing them to make some decisions. There are some ways you can help your teens create reasonable structure and remain close. One way is to spend time together. Parents often mistake their teens increased interest in friends for a disinterest in the family. Teens would like to spend more time doing things with their parents, but watching TV is not counted as spending time together. As your teens mature, it is important for you and your teens spend time alone together, one to one. Your teens need time to talk to you alone without any other family member present. Talk with your teens about their interests and concerns. Make sure you really show interest in what is happening. When talking with your teens, give full attention and do not stop them. The way to help your teens become adults is to let your teens into your world. Sharing your emotions and concerns with your teens is important. Avoid causing needless worry. Trust your teens. Dont expect the worst. Hope for the best. Telling your teens you dont like their friends will cause the teens not to bring their friends home. If something should go wrong, believe that your teens didnt do it on purpose. It is very important that you treat your teens with respect. Teens need the same respect adults show for total strangers. Dont talk down to your teens. You need to be supportive of your teens. What may be a small problem to you may be troubling to your teens. Teens dont have the experiences that adults have had. Let the teens know that you understand how much it hurts when something happens that is upsetting or hurtful to them. As they mature, they can look back at some problems they had and laugh at having been upset by something that now seems unimportant. The most important things to remember are: talk with your teens, listen to their worries and offer suggestions when needed. This will help your teens to live a well-organized life. (8分)阅读理解 As a new immigrant (移民) in Australia, I sometimes find it hard to get into the local culture. After reading the book Unpolished Gem (未经雕琢的宝石) by Australian writer Alice Pung, I found I am not alone. Pung had the same story as me.The story is set in Melbourne. Pungs parents are from Cambodia. They have lived in Australia for years. But Pung still has difficulties understanding both cultures.One is the white Australian culture she lives in. The other is her familys traditional Asian values (价值观). For example, her parents tell her, You are going to be a lawyer and marry a doctor. This makes Pung want to run away from her life. However, as she argues with her white boyfriend, she knows that traditional Asian values are part of her life. In the end, she happily accepts her own cultural background (背景).Since Pung lived in her home country for 18 years, it wasnt easy for her to understand Australian culture. I have found that I feel the same way sometimes. In Asian culture, we put a lot of importance on our studies and getting into a good college. But it seems like Western kids are more carefree.I liked this book because it really shows what its like to live as an immigrant.
